But behind every great trick shot is angle math, spin control, and hours of practice. Here we break down the most effective trick shots for Carrom Pool Disc Pool.
This is the bread and butter of Carrom Pool Trick Shots Disc Pool. Place your striker slightly off-center, apply backspin, and aim for the disc at a 35° angle. The disc will "pinch" between the striker and the pocket edge. Success rate: 78% in pro matches. Check out more easy trick shots here →
Popularised by Chennai-based player Arun "SpinKing" K., this shot uses heavy topspin to make the striker bounce off the back rail and return to strike a second disc. It looks flashy, but with practice it becomes a reliable weapon. Key: keep your wrist loose and follow through.
In disc pool, you often have 3–4 discs clustered near a pocket. Instead of picking them one by one, use a power striker with medium spin to trigger a chain reaction. This is a high-risk, high-reward move — but when it works, it clears the board in one go. Discover more gameplay tricks →
A signature move in Carrom Pool Trick Shots Disc Pool among Western India players. Hold the striker between thumb and middle finger, flick with extreme wrist snap. The disc gets an unpredictable spin that confuses opponents. Pro tip: use this only on boards with low friction.
Sometimes the best trick shot is the one that doesn't look like a trick shot. Place your striker dead center, apply zero spin, and tap gently. The disc moves slowly, almost hesitantly, and drops into the pocket as if by magic. Mind game: your opponent will think you got lucky — but you know better.
Every degree matters. Use the practice mode to memorize 15°, 30°, 45° angles. Pro players train with a protractor — yes, really!
Topspin = speed. Backspin = control. Sidespin = chaos. Master all three to become unpredictable.
In disc pool, the power meter is your enemy. Learn to release at 60–70% for maximum trick shot consistency.
Before you strike, close your eyes for 1 second and visualise the path. This is a technique used by 9 out of 10 pro players.

Knowing individual trick shots is great, but winning consistently requires a strategic framework. Here's how the top 1% of Carrom Pool Trick Shots Disc Pool players think.
When a new board loads, don't rush. Scan the disc positions, identify clusters, and plan your first 3 moves. Champion players spend 70% of their time observing and only 30% executing. Play online and practice board reading →
Every shot in disc pool consumes energy. If you waste power on flashy trick shots early, you'll run out of steam in the final round. Rule of thumb: use power shots only when you have a 90%+ chance of pocketing. Otherwise, play safe.
Carrom is as much a mental game as a physical one. Use the in-game chat to stay calm, compliment your opponent's good shots, and never show frustration. Data: players who maintain positive chat have a 23% higher win rate in ranked disc pool matches.

We sat down with Vikram "FlickMaster" Singh, a 24-year-old from Jaipur who climbed from rank 45,000 to top 50 in Carrom Pool Trick Shots Disc Pool in just 6 months. Here's what he shared:
"People think trick shots are just for show. But in disc pool, trick shots are the most efficient way to clear clusters. I developed my own shot called the 'Jaipur Jumper' — it's a double-bank shot that uses the rail twice before hitting the disc. I practiced it 2,000 times before I used it in a ranked match."
Q: What's your advice for beginners?
"Don't chase fancy shots. Master the basic 30° backspin first. That one shot will win you 80% of your matches. Then add one new trick shot every week. Slow and steady."
Q: How do you handle pressure?
"I take a deep breath and remind myself — it's just a game. But also, I have a playlist of lo-fi beats that keeps me calm. Find what works for you."
